AARTI A RITUAL OF LIGHT
  • Aarti is a Hindu religious ritual where devotees
    offer light (usually from wicks soaked in ghee)
    to the deities. It's performed multiple times a
    day, especially during the early morning and
    evening. As part of the Mathura pilgrimage tour,
    devotees often visit the Banke Bihari Temple and
    Rangji Temple in Vrindavan, which are
    particularly famous for their grand Aarti
    ceremonies.

4
  • Symbolizes the removal of darkness (ignorance)
    and the ushering in of light (knowledge).
  • Represents surrendering to the divine and seeking
    blessings.
  • The rhythmic chantings and clanging bells during
    Aarti intensify the spiritual atmosphere.

BHAJANS MELODIES OF DEVOTION
  • Bhajans are devotional songs dedicated to Lord
    Krishna and other deities.
  • Sung with deep reverence, these hymns describe
    the tales, adventures, and teachings of Lord
    Krishna.
  • Places like ISKCON temple in Vrindavan are hubs
    for soulful Bhajan sessions, where devotees
    gather in large numbers to sing collectively.

SATSANGS CONGREGATIONS OF TRUTH SEEKERS
  • Satsang translates to 'association with Truth'.
  • It's a gathering where spiritual seekers come
    together to meditate, discuss scriptures, and
    share experiences.
  • In Mathura-Vrindavan, Satsangs are often
    accompanied by stories from the life of Lord
    Krishna, emphasizing his teachings and
    philosophies.
